Calcul de l’inverse d’une matrice 3 3 logiciel
Entrez les 9 coefficients de votre matrice 3×3, choisissez le niveau de précision et obtenez instantanément le déterminant, l’adjointe, l’inverse et une visualisation graphique utile pour l’analyse numérique.
Calculatrice d’inverse de matrice 3×3
Résultats
Saisissez votre matrice 3×3 puis cliquez sur Calculer l’inverse.
Guide expert du calcul de l’inverse d’une matrice 3×3 avec un logiciel
Le calcul de l’inverse d’une matrice 3 3 logiciel est une opération fondamentale en algèbre linéaire, en calcul scientifique, en traitement du signal, en robotique, en infographie 3D, en économie quantitative et en ingénierie. Dès qu’un problème se formule sous la forme d’un système linéaire A x = b, la question de l’inversion de la matrice A apparaît. Dans la pratique, un logiciel spécialisé ou une calculatrice numérique permet d’obtenir un résultat rapide, mais encore faut-il comprendre ce qui est réellement calculé, quelles sont les limites numériques, et dans quels cas une matrice 3×3 est ou non inversible.
Une matrice carrée 3×3 est inversible si et seulement si son déterminant est non nul. Cela signifie qu’il existe une matrice A-1 telle que A × A-1 = I, où I est la matrice identité. Le rôle d’un bon logiciel n’est pas seulement d’afficher les neuf coefficients de l’inverse. Il doit également détecter les cas singuliers, signaler les erreurs de saisie, gérer la précision décimale, et parfois même proposer des indicateurs de stabilité numérique.
Point clé : pour une matrice 3×3, le calcul exact de l’inverse se fait classiquement via le déterminant, la matrice des cofacteurs, puis l’adjointe. Les logiciels modernes utilisent souvent des méthodes plus robustes pour les matrices plus grandes, mais pour 3×3, la formule analytique reste rapide, claire et très pédagogique.
Pourquoi utiliser un logiciel pour inverser une matrice 3×3 ?
Sur le papier, le calcul manuel est faisable. Toutefois, il est source d’erreurs, notamment lors du calcul des mineurs, des cofacteurs et du signe alterné. Dans un contexte professionnel, un logiciel de calcul de l’inverse d’une matrice 3×3 apporte plusieurs avantages :
- réduction du risque d’erreur de calcul manuel ;
- gain de temps immédiat pour les étudiants, enseignants et ingénieurs ;
- contrôle de l’inversibilité via le déterminant ;
- choix d’une précision d’affichage adaptée au besoin ;
- visualisation de mesures numériques comme les sommes absolues par ligne ;
- intégration facile dans des flux de travail plus larges.
Rappel mathématique sur l’inverse d’une matrice 3×3
Soit la matrice suivante :
Son déterminant se calcule avec la formule :
Si ce déterminant est nul, l’inverse n’existe pas. S’il est différent de zéro, alors :
où adj(A) est l’adjointe, c’est-à-dire la transposée de la matrice des cofacteurs. Un bon outil logiciel automatise ces étapes en quelques millisecondes.
Étapes qu’un bon logiciel suit en arrière-plan
- Lecture des 9 entrées : le programme vérifie que chaque coefficient est un nombre valide.
- Construction de la matrice : les valeurs sont placées dans un tableau 3×3.
- Calcul du déterminant : c’est le premier test d’inversibilité.
- Création des mineurs et cofacteurs : chaque coefficient de l’adjointe est dérivé d’un mineur 2×2.
- Division par le déterminant : si le déterminant est suffisamment éloigné de zéro, on obtient l’inverse.
- Formatage du résultat : le logiciel arrondit ou affiche les décimales selon votre choix.
- Contrôle visuel : certains outils ajoutent un graphique ou des métriques supplémentaires.
Précision numérique : pourquoi le résultat peut varier selon le logiciel
Il est fréquent d’obtenir des chiffres légèrement différents entre deux outils. Ce n’est pas forcément une erreur. Beaucoup de logiciels grand public reposent sur le format IEEE 754 double précision, qui stocke les nombres avec 64 bits, dont 53 bits significatifs pour la mantisse. Cela donne environ 15 à 16 chiffres décimaux significatifs. Ce niveau de précision est excellent pour la plupart des usages courants, mais il ne supprime pas totalement les erreurs d’arrondi.
| Standard ou outil | Type numérique courant | Précision significative typique | Donnée notable |
|---|---|---|---|
| IEEE 754 double précision | 64 bits | 15 à 16 chiffres | Machine epsilon ≈ 2,22 × 10-16 |
| NumPy Python | float64 par défaut | 15 à 16 chiffres | Très utilisé en calcul scientifique |
| MATLAB | double par défaut | 15 à 16 chiffres | Référence académique et ingénierie |
| R | double | 15 à 16 chiffres | Fréquent en statistique et modélisation |
La valeur de 2,22 × 10-16 correspond à la machine epsilon pour la double précision IEEE 754, un repère central en analyse numérique. Si votre matrice a un déterminant extrêmement petit, le logiciel peut produire une inverse théoriquement correcte mais numériquement instable. Dans ce cas, une petite variation sur les coefficients initiaux peut entraîner une grande variation sur le résultat final.
Comment repérer une matrice presque singulière
- le déterminant est très proche de zéro ;
- les coefficients de l’inverse deviennent très grands ;
- de petites erreurs de saisie changent fortement le résultat ;
- la résolution de A x = b semble très sensible aux arrondis.
Logiciel, tableur, langage scientifique : lequel choisir ?
Le choix dépend du contexte. Un étudiant qui vérifie un exercice de cours n’a pas les mêmes besoins qu’un ingénieur qui traite des milliers de systèmes. Pour une simple matrice 3×3, un outil web est souvent suffisant. Pour des workflows plus avancés, Python, MATLAB ou R restent préférables. Les tableurs peuvent aussi convenir, mais avec des limites documentées.
| Solution | Avantage principal | Limite principale | Statistique réelle utile |
|---|---|---|---|
| Outil web spécialisé | Rapide et accessible | Dépend de l’implémentation | Usage immédiat sans installation |
| Excel | Familier pour beaucoup d’utilisateurs | Fonction MINVERSE limitée | Matrices jusqu’à 52 × 52 selon la documentation |
| Python avec NumPy | Automatisation et scripts | Demande un environnement technique | float64 par défaut sur la plupart des installations |
| MATLAB | Très robuste en milieu scientifique | Coût de licence | double précision standard en calcul matriciel |
Cas d’usage concrets du calcul de l’inverse d’une matrice 3×3
1. Résolution de systèmes linéaires
Si vous avez trois équations à trois inconnues, l’inverse de la matrice des coefficients permet d’écrire directement x = A-1b. Dans un environnement pédagogique, cela aide à vérifier un exercice. En ingénierie, cela intervient dans des sous-problèmes de petite dimension intégrés à des modèles plus vastes.
2. Graphisme et transformations géométriques
Les matrices 3×3 apparaissent dans les transformations de rotation, d’échelle, de cisaillement ou dans certaines opérations sur des coordonnées homogènes 2D. Inverser une transformation permet de revenir à l’état initial ou de convertir un point dans un repère différent.
3. Robotique et vision
Dans les modèles cinématiques ou les changements de bases locaux, les petites matrices carrées sont omniprésentes. Une inversion stable et rapide est alors indispensable, notamment dans les boucles de calcul temps réel.
4. Économie quantitative et statistiques
Même si les modèles réels utilisent souvent des matrices plus grandes, le cas 3×3 reste utile pour des exemples, des sous-modèles et des démonstrations analytiques. C’est aussi une excellente porte d’entrée pour comprendre les principes qui gouvernent les solveurs matriciels plus complexes.
Bonnes pratiques pour utiliser un logiciel de calcul matriciel
- Vérifiez les entrées : une simple erreur de signe change complètement l’inverse.
- Regardez le déterminant avant l’inverse : s’il est nul ou proche de zéro, soyez prudent.
- Choisissez la bonne précision : 4 à 6 décimales suffisent souvent pour un contrôle rapide.
- Contrôlez la cohérence : si possible, multipliez A par A-1 pour vérifier que vous obtenez presque l’identité.
- Évitez d’inverser inutilement : en calcul scientifique, résoudre directement un système est souvent préférable à l’inversion explicite.
Pourquoi cette calculatrice affiche aussi un graphique
Un graphique ne remplace pas la théorie, mais il améliore l’interprétation. En affichant les sommes absolues par ligne de la matrice initiale et de son inverse, on obtient une lecture intuitive de l’amplification numérique. Si les valeurs de l’inverse sont très élevées alors que la matrice initiale semble modérée, c’est souvent le signe d’une matrice mal conditionnée ou presque singulière. Cette lecture visuelle est très utile pour les étudiants, les formateurs et les utilisateurs non spécialistes de l’analyse numérique.
Erreurs fréquentes à éviter
- croire qu’une matrice carrée est toujours inversible ;
- ignorer le déterminant et se focaliser uniquement sur le résultat final ;
- arrondir trop tôt pendant un calcul manuel ;
- confondre transposée et inverse ;
- oublier qu’une matrice de rotation orthogonale a une inverse égale à sa transposée uniquement dans des cas particuliers structurés.
Ressources de référence à consulter
Pour approfondir les aspects mathématiques et numériques, vous pouvez consulter des sources académiques et institutionnelles reconnues :
- MIT – 18.06 Linear Algebra
- NIST – National Institute of Standards and Technology
- University of Wisconsin – Linear Algebra Review
Conclusion
Le calcul de l’inverse d’une matrice 3 3 logiciel est à la fois simple en apparence et riche en implications numériques. Pour un usage scolaire, une calculatrice web bien conçue donne un retour immédiat, clair et pédagogique. Pour un usage professionnel, la compréhension du déterminant, de la précision numérique et de la stabilité du problème reste essentielle. La bonne démarche consiste donc à ne pas seulement demander au logiciel un résultat, mais à interpréter ce résultat avec méthode : vérifier l’inversibilité, observer l’échelle des coefficients, choisir une précision adaptée, et garder en tête que l’inversion n’est fiable que si la matrice est correctement conditionnée. Avec ces réflexes, un outil logiciel devient non seulement rapide, mais véritablement utile et rigoureux.